Official RIAA Diamond Award commemorating the success of Creed’s 1999 album Human Clay, measuring 16? tall and weighing 10.35 pounds, consisting of a large crystal diamond displayed atop a glass obelisk set upon a black base, with an engraved plaque reading: “Diamond Award, Presented to Jeff Cameron in recognition of ‘Human Clay,’ by Creed and the Recording Industry Association of America, 10 Million U.S. Sales, July 16, 2001.” In very good to fine condition, with the diamond and metal support re-glued at the top. Designed by Peter Wayne Yenawine, a master designer at Steuben Glass, these distinctive diamond award sculptures are made of fine lead crystal and of the utmost desirability.
